Rachakonda is a village with a population of 1300, which is the 7th least populous village, located in the Narayanpur sub-district of the Yadadri Bhuvanagiri district in the state of Telangana in India. The nearest town to this village is Nalgonda, and the distance from Rachakonda village to Nalgonda is 65 km. Rachakonda is famous because of its ancient memories. It reminds us of the 14th century.
